The multilinear pseudo-differential operators with symbols in the multilinear Hörmander class S0,0 are considered. A complete identification of the cases where those operators define bounded operators between local Hardy spaces is given. Some results for the boundedness between Wiener amalgam spaces are also given. These are extensions and improvements of the results known in the bilinear case.
